Martie Posted July 4, 2020 Share Posted July 4, 2020 Problem solved i deleted the Documents\Prepar3D v4 Add-ons\Orbx ObjectFlow 2 folder and than I add this object Flow 2 via Orbx Central and now everything is ok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
espresso Posted July 10, 2020 Share Posted July 10, 2020 Had the same problem after a fresh install of P3Dv5. Culprit was Object Flow not being installed automatically. @developers: Why is Object Flow not automatically installed as soon as an addon needs it?
